The new episode of the Baku TV program Aktual Gündəm ("Current Agenda") discussed the negotiations between the USA and Iran.
Experts examined why Tehran agreed to dialogue at the last moment and whether pressure from Russia could have influenced this, as well as assessed the prospects of a possible agreement and Iran's readiness to make concessions.
Special attention was given to the internal situation: the intensification of disagreements and whether a potential agreement could provoke a split in the country. The discussion covered which position would prevail - that of compromise supporters or hardliners.
Their assessments were shared by the head of the Center for Political and Legal Studies Khayal Bashirov, military expert Adalyat Verdiyev, as well as political analysts Anar Aliyev and Alimusa Ibragimov.
